The ingredients needed to make Red Velevet Cream Cheese Cake Cookies:
  1. Make ready 1 box red velvet cake mix (16.5oz. box)
  2. Get 1/2 cup butter, room temp plus
  3. Get 2 tbsp butter, melted
  4. Take 8 oz cream cheese, room temp
  5. Take 1 large egg
  6. Get 1 powdered sugar for decoration
Instructions to make Red Velevet Cream Cheese Cake Cookies:
  1. preheat oven to 350
  2. beat butters and cream cheese.
  3. add egg.
  4. stir in cake mix.
  5. drop by the rounded teaspoonfull onto parchment lined cookie sheet or use baking spray.
  6. bake 10-12 min. or until desired doneness..
  7. remove to wire rack to cool.
  8. once cool. dust tops of cookies with powdered sugar. use as much or as little as u would like.
  9. serve!
  10. HINT; u can use margarine… and u can add more red food color for a brighter red color. (I added 30 drops.)
